Regional Sales Manager - North Atlantic US & Canada
AMETEK is a leading global provider of industrial technology solutions serving diverse markets. The Regional Sales Manager will be responsible for driving sales in the North Atlantic US & Canada, identifying new business opportunities, and building strong client relationships.

Responsibilities
Manage direct sales for assigned territory
Successfully demonstrate our hardware and software technologies to potential customers
Prepare and submit monthly sales forecast for designated territory; effectively use our CRM to provide insight into active opportunities in all stages of the sales cycle
Drive performance in designated territory
Foster a system integrator program in territory
Forecast and evaluate sales drivers and identify new opportunities
Plan weekly travel schedule to maximize the amount of face time with customers, identifying customer locations that can be added to the travel schedule
Utilize the full capability of our CRM system for documenting the sales process by scheduling future activity and follow-ups in the system
Submit weekly reports for update on sales activity
Participate in weekly sales calls to provide sales activity update and discuss strategy
Request support from team when customer needs prompt attention or follow-up assistance and verify that needed action has been taken
Build internal relationships with our Applications, Marketing, and Engineering groups utilizing their support as needed to close the sales
Routinely review and adjust business plan and identify top prospects
Generate leads through industry networking, asking for referrals when appropriate
Participate in trade shows and company seminars as required
Participate in quarterly meetings with Sales team as an opportunity for territory planning and sales management support efforts
Develop presentations and sales materials as needed
Partner with Marketing on lead generation
Develop an understanding of our product lines and how they meet various customer needs and applications
Perform other related duties as assigned or as required
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ering, Physics, or Computer Science. Relevant experience will be considered
5 years of progressive field engineering/sales experience
Experience in data acquisition, embedded control, test and measurement, or a closely related field
Travel requirement: 60%
Due to the nature of UEI's programs and products, applicants must have the legal right to work in the U.S. and additionally must be legally authorized to access export-controlled information and source code
Preferred
Prior experience in aerospace, space, and/or defense department sales
A desire to be customer-facing
Outstanding verbal, written, and presentation skills, including the ability to explain technical information
Outstanding strategic skills with solid creative thinking
Detail oriented and self-starter
Results oriented and deadline management driven
Ability to work from our Norwood, MA office when not traveling to customers is strongly preferred
